Japanese SBI exchange extends its crypto lending services

The subsidiary of SBI Group, SBI Trade VC, has announced that today at 8:00 p.m. local time, it begins a new round of staking to accept the following cryptocurrencies from its users for further lending: BTC, BCH, XRP, DOGE, XLM, DAI and ZPG — seven coins in total.

Lenders will be entitled to receive “rental fees” regularly, depending on the asset they lend.

SBI Trade VC has launched the lending service despite the current bloodbath on the global cryptocurrency market, allowing those who hold on to their cryptos to make some additional passive income through DeFi.

Binance completes conversion of its SAFU fund into Bitcoin

While the crypto market is bleeding after Bitcoin crashed from $90,000 to the $60,000 level and then managed to pare some of its losses, the world’s largest crypto exchange, Binance, has made a bullish announcement to its global community.

At the end of January, Binance stepped forward with a decision to fully convert its $1 billion SAFU fund, formed in case of hacker attacks to compensate users’ losses, into the world’s largest cryptocurrency, Bitcoin.

Over the past two weeks, it has made regular Bitcoin purchases, adding more BTC to its corporate stash. The final tranche conducted today contained 4,545 BTC worth approximately $309,288,522 at the time of writing. Binance published a report to share this news with the community.

Now, the SAFU fund holds 15,000 Bitcoin valued at $1,005,000,000 at the time of completion (at a Bitcoin price of $67,000). Binance has stressed that it fully trusts in Bitcoin as its long-term reserve asset: “With SAFU Fund now fully in Bitcoin, we reinforce our belief in BTC as the premier long-term reserve asset.”

CME to launch Solana and XRP futures options on October 13, 2025

CME to launch Solana and XRP futures options on October 13, 2025

The post CME to launch Solana and XRP futures options on October 13, 2025 app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. Key Takeaways CME Group will launch futures options for Solana (SOL) and XRP. The launch date is set for October 13, 2025. CME Group will launch futures options for Solana and XRP on October 13, 2025. The Chicago-based derivatives exchange will add the new crypto derivatives products to its existing digital asset offerings. The launch will provide institutional and retail traders with additional tools to hedge positions and speculate on price movements for both digital assets. The futures options will be based on CME’s existing Solana and XRP futures contracts. Trading will be conducted through CME Globex, the exchange’s electronic trading platform.
